
Rokit Healthcare, a leading AI-driven, personalized regenerative medicine platform, announced on Thursday that it has entered into a strategic partnership with Company A, the UAE’s largest healthcare firm. This collaboration aims to expand Rokit’s presence in the Middle Eastern and global markets.
The agreement was officially signed on January 14 during the JP Morgan Healthcare Conference. This partnership marks a pivotal moment for Rokit Healthcare, as its long-term regeneration platform has gained strategic endorsement from key Middle Eastern capital and medical networks, potentially leading to a significant reevaluation of the company’s value.
The partner company is a crucial AI and healthcare-focused subsidiary of a major UAE holding firm with strong ties to the region’s sovereign wealth funds and global investment entities. Both companies have agreed to merge Rokit Healthcare’s cutting-edge regenerative medicine solutions with the partner’s extensive medical infrastructure, aiming to create powerful synergies that could revolutionize the global biotech landscape.
The partnership will primarily focus on local validation and large-scale commercialization of Rokit Healthcare’s AI-powered cartilage regeneration technology. Both parties have prioritized confirming the clinical efficacy of this technology, with plans for substantial follow-up investments and global market commercialization once validation is complete.
Given Rokit Healthcare’s already advanced technological capabilities, this validation process is expected to be the final step before securing significant capital investment.
Rokit Healthcare plans to leverage this partnership to establish the Middle East as a strategic hub for its global expansion. Backed by the partner’s established network and financial resources, the company aims to swiftly gain market dominance in the highly competitive global regenerative medicine sector.
